Modify This Mail Session

post

/management/weblogic/{version}/edit/partitions/{name}/resourceGroups/{name}/mailSessions/{name}

Modify this mail session.

  • Minimum Value: 0
    Maximum Value: 2147483647
    Default Value: 1000

    A priority that the server uses to determine when it deploys an item. The priority is relative to other deployable items of the same type.

    For example, the server prioritizes and deploys all EJBs before it prioritizes and deploys startup classes.

    Items with the lowest Deployment Order value are deployed first. There is no guarantee on the order of deployments with equal Deployment Order values. There is no guarantee of ordering across clusters.

  • Properties
    Title: Properties
    Additional Properties Allowed: additionalProperties

    The configuration options and user authentication data that this mail session uses to interact with a mail server. Each property that you specify overrides the default property value as defined by the JavaMail API Design Specification.

    Include only the properties defined by the JavaMail API Design Specification.

    If you do not specify any properties, this mail session will use the JavaMail default property values.

    Express each property as a namevalue pair. Separate multiple properties with a semicolon ().

  • The decrypted JavaMail Session password attribute, for use only temporarily in-memory; the value returned by this attribute should not be held in memory long term.

    The value is stored in an encrypted form in the descriptor file and when displayed in an administration console.

  • Returns the username to be used to create an authenticated JavaMail Session, using a JavaMail Authenticator instance; if this is not set, it will be assumed that the Session is not to be authenticated.
